  • Publication number: 20260078227
    Abstract: The present disclosure provides poly(tetrafluoroethylene) (PTFE) microparticles with a Dv50 of about 20 ?m to about 30 ?m and a specific surface area (SSA) of at least about 3.0 m2/g when measured by a multipoint BET method of ISO 9277. Such PTFE microparticles can be obtained via a method including thermomechanically degrading scrap PTFE in the presence of air and/or oxygen and reducing the particle size of the resultant degraded PTFE.

  • Publication number: 20250381322
    Abstract: A common issue when building a catheter with a laser-cut hypotube is bonding the OD (outer diameter) of the PTFE or PE liner to the ID (inner diameter) of an adjacent component, e.g., a laser-cut hypotube An expandable tie layer or “heat grow tie layer” as described herein can be used as a coating for the liner that will expand or foam up to the ID (inner diameter) of an adjacent component, e.g., hypotube and improve adhesion to the hypotube without impacting the flexibility or lubricity of the liner. This and other applications of the expandable layer are described herein.

  • Publication number: 20250303656
    Abstract: The disclosure relates to assemblies of thin-walled tubes and mandrels for use in thin wall catheter liners. For example, an assembly is provided that includes a thin-walled PTFE tube comprising walls with a thickness of less than 0.004 inches, positioned over a filled mandrel comprising PTFE with one or more fillers incorporated therein. The disclosure further provides, independently, thin-walled tubes and filled mandrels, as well as methods of making and using such components.

  • Publication number: 20250018629
    Abstract: The disclosure generally relates to ultra high molecular weight poly (ethylene) (“UHMWPE”) tubes with an average wall thickness of 0.2 mm or less; a tensile stress at break greater than 40 MPa; and a storage modulus of greater than 500 MPa at 23° C. The disclosure further relates to preparing and using such tubes and to constructions (e.g., catheter constructions) and components thereof including such tubes.

  • Publication number: 20240408283
    Abstract: The disclosure provides coated tubings, including a layer of PEBA (or other polymer) on an etched polymeric tubing. The layer of PEBA (or other polymer) can have a low thickness, e.g., less than 1 micron and can provide for efficient bonding to an overlying jacket layer. The disclosure further provides methods of making and using such coated tubings.

  • Publication number: 20240228763
    Abstract: The present disclosure provides extruded PTFE composite tubes with a reduced coefficient of friction (COF). In some embodiments, such extruded PTFE composite tubes may exhibit a reduced change in coefficient of friction between about 20° C. and about 40° C. with the inclusion of secondary polymeric particles with small particle sizes (<100 ?m) at loading percentages of less than about 50 weight %.
